Output d80b8bcba06fad259655dd346a1132cb7e0d3aba9dc127fbd31ed95a2a3668a3:3

value
1922945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d569551bb53a64d3a9a97f4665513a5a5e3180e OP_EQUAL
address
38jwgE5g3qLkP6pM5LUpet4dS4iSH2jT7i
transaction
d80b8bcba06fad259655dd346a1132cb7e0d3aba9dc127fbd31ed95a2a3668a3